zammad/app/models/taskbar/init/ticket.rb
2026-01-02 15:41:09 +02:00

12 lines
349 B
Ruby

# Copyright (C) 2012-2026 Zammad Foundation, https://zammad-foundation.org/
class Taskbar::Init::Ticket < Taskbar::Init::Backend
def data(result)
TicketPolicy::ReadScope
.new(current_user, Ticket.where(id: ticket_ids))
.resolve
.each_with_object({}) do |elem, _memo|
elem.assets(result[:assets])
end
end
end